Definition and Scope

So, what is technology development? In the simplest terms, it involves the creation, improvement, and adaptation of technological solutions to meet emerging requirements and overcome existing limitations. This comprehensive process spans research and development (R&D), design, prototyping, testing, and commercialization, demanding a multidisciplinary approach that incorporates insights from science, engineering, business, and social sciences.

Key Components of Technology Development

To illustrate the intricacies of technology development, we can break it down into several core components:

  • Market Analysis and Research: Identifying emerging trends, user needs, and societal demands to inform the development process.
  • Innovation and Ideation: Generating and exploring novel ideas, concepts, and solutions through brainstorming, prototyping, and experimentation.
  • Design and Engineering: Refining and refining the idea, developing functional prototypes, and optimizing performance.
  • Pilot Testing and Validation: Gathering feedback, identifying issues, and ensuring the technology meets predefined standards.
  • Commercialization and Scaling: Implementing the technology, addressing production and deployment challenges, and achieving widespread adoption.

Process and Challenges

The journey of technology development is marked by its iterative nature, where continuous refinement and improvement are essential to overcome technical, social, and economic hurdles. Several key challenges are often encountered along the way, including:

  • Talent Acquisition and Retention: Securing and developing the skills needed to drive the development process, often requiring significant investments in training, mentoring, and research.
  • Funding and Resource Allocation: Securing financial and material resources, including government grants, venture capital, or crowdfunding, to support and accelerate the tech development process.
  • Regulatory and Compliance: Navigating a complex web of regulatory frameworks, ensuring products meet safety and efficacy standards, and maintaining transparency throughout the development process.
  • Social and Ethical Implications: Addressing the impact of emerging technologies on human well-being, privacy, and the environment, often demanding novel solutions and policy responses.

Real-World Examples and Success Stories

Technology development has given rise to groundbreaking innovations in various sectors, from medicine and transportation to education and renewable energy. Here are a few notable examples:

Smart Homes and Energy Efficiency: The development of smart thermostats and energy management systems has significantly improved energy efficiency, allowing households to reduce energy consumption and minimize environmental impact.

Artificial Intelligence in Healthcare: AI-powered diagnostic tools and robotic surgery systems have revolutionized the medical field, enabling doctors to make more accurate diagnoses and perform complex procedures with increased precision and speed.

Electric Vehicles and Sustainable Mobility: The advent of electric vehicles and advanced public transportation systems has contributed to a significant reduction in greenhouse gas emissions, transforming the future of transportation and urban planning.
